“If when I am able to discover something which has baffled others, I forget Him who revealeth the deep and secret things, and knoweth what is in the darkness and showeth it to us; if I forget that it was He who granted that ray of light to His most unworthy servant, then I know nothing of Calvary love.”

Amy Carmichael

About This Quote

Source Book: The Golden Dawn by Amy Carmichael, 1915

Recognizing that divine insight comes from God, not personal achievement, and staying humble in gratitude for His gifts.

In simple terms: God gives insight; we must remember Him.
